TítuloLinksys RE6500、RE6250、RE6300、RE6350、RE7000、RE9000 RE6500(1.0.013.001) RE6250(1.0.04.001) RE6300(1.2.07.001) RE6350(1.0.04.001) RE7000(1.1.05.003) RE9000(1.0.04.002) OS Command Injection
DescriçãoWe found an command Injection vulnerability in Linksys router with firmware which was released recently,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ary OS commands from a crafted request.In setDeviceName function, DeviceName is directly passed by the attacker, so we can control the DeviceName to attack the OS.
